General Rules
In Sidney, roofing permits enforce the Ohio Building Code and local standards for fire safety, wind resistance, and structural integrity.
Permits are typically required for work that alters the roof structure or covers a significant portion of the existing roof.
When Permits Are Required
Common situations where permits are often needed:
- Full roof replacements or re-roofing over 25% of the surface.
- Installing skylights, vents, solar panels, or dormers.
- Structural repairs to rafters, trusses, or decking.
- Commercial roofs with changes to drainage, parapets, or mechanical systems.
Verify with local inspectors as thresholds can vary.
Common Exemptions
Work that may be exempt:
- Minor repairs like replacing a few shingles or patching leaks.
- Like-for-like maintenance without structural changes.
Even if exempt, document work for insurance and resale.

Permit Process
1. Confirm permit need
Discuss your project with the local building department to see if a permit applies.
2. Prepare application materials
Gather roof plans, material specifications, contractor details, and photos of the existing roof.
3. Submit the application
File online or in person with required documentation.
4. Review and approval
Await code review; respond to any requests for revisions.
5. Start work and inspections
Begin after approval. Schedule inspections for tear-off, sheathing, and final walkthrough.
Compliance Tips
- ✓ Partner with licensed, local contractors who know Sidney codes and can handle permitting.
- ✓ Choose materials rated for Ohio's snow and wind loads to pass inspections easily.
- ✓ Document everything – photos before/during/after help with warranties and claims.
- ✓ Apply early; coordinating permits prevents delays in rainy seasons.
- ✓ Avoid shortcuts: Unpermitted work risks fines, insurance denial, or forced removal.
Special Considerations
HOA Rules
HOAs in Sidney neighborhoods may require prior approval beyond city permits. Review covenants for material and color restrictions.
Zoning
Zoning rules may limit roof height, pitch, or materials. Confirm setbacks and use restrictions with local planning.
Historic Properties
Properties in Sidney's historic areas often need design review. Check if your address qualifies for extra preservation oversight.
